Your Committee on Education, to which was referred S.B. No. 670 entitled:

"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O THE HAWAII STATE STUDENT COUNCIL,"

begs leave to report as follows:

The purpose of this measure is to establish a Hawaii State Student Council within the Hawaii Revised Statutes.

Your Committee received testimony in favor of this measure from the Department of Education, the student member of the Board of Education, and two high school students.

Your Committee finds that Hawaii's students need a forum for discussing important issues relating to their concerns, responsibilities, and goals. The Hawaii State Student Council has provided this forum successfully for a number of years. This measure formally codifies the establishment of the Hawaii State Student Council. In addition, this measure authorizes the council to elect the student member of the Board of Education.

Your Committee has amended this measure by changing the effective date to December 28, 2050.

As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Education that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of S.B. No. 670, as amended herein, and recommends that it pass Second Reading in the form attached hereto as S.B. No. 670, S.D. 1, and be referred to the Committee on Ways and Means.
